What to Expect
This conference brings together clinicians, researchers, advocates, and policymakers from across Canada to advance a shared goal: equitable, affirming cancer care for 2SLGBTQI+ communities. Over 1.5 days plus a half day workshop, the program moves through the full cancer continuum, from prevention and screening to survivorship, with space for both evidence and experience.
Audience: Healthcare professionals, researchers, 2SLGBTQI+ advocates, community organizations, students and policy partners.
Dates: Thursday June 11 and Friday June 12, 2026
Time: 9:00am - 5:00pm EST
Location: Pierre-Péladeau Amphitheater (CHUM)
1050 R. Saint-Denis, Montréal, QC. Canada. H2X 3J4
